CDS Visual provides a cloud solution that is trusted by many of the world’s biggest industrial suppliers. The roots of the company include a core competency around industrial product data, sourcing, normalization, and modeling. When combined with an extensive offering of 3D visualization solutions, CDS is uniquely able to re-purpose existing CAD assets to deliver impactful solutions. From catalog products to configured-to-order products, CDS solutions complement our clients’ websites, CPQ, and eCommerce solutions by enhancing, enriching, and unifying their product content to achieve increased conversions. For clients that sell engineered-to-order products, we offer solutions that include configuration, BOM, 3D CAD, manufacturing drawings, and augmented reality. Position Summary: Reporting to the Senior Director of Software Engineering, the Director of Software Engineering will spearhead R&D initiatives for innovative digital products including 3D visualization technologies like Three.js and WebGL. This position involves collaborating with cross-functional and cross-company teams to incubate solutions that drive revenue and customer engagement. The role demands strategic leadership coupled with tactical execution to develop and maintain a robust digital product portfolio on a connected platform. Responsibilities: Lead SaaS Digital Solutions: Direct end-to-end development of cloud and edge-centric digital solutions such as visual configurators, SaaS solutions that enhance real-time 3D data & visualization, interactive digital content creation across platforms. Innovate with Cutting-Edge Technologies: Utilize Three.js, WebGL, and other 3D technologies to push the boundaries of what is possible in digital product visualization, ensuring solutions are at the forefront of industry trends. Matrix Management: Effectively manage teams through a matrix structure; responsible for hiring, mentoring, career development, and performance management of team members. Vendor and Budget Management: Oversee vendor relationships and budget allocations to ensure projects are delivered efficiently without compromising on quality. Collaborate Across Functions: Work closely with Digital Program and Project Managers and operational teams to ensure successful, on-time delivery of solutions. Technical Leadership and Mentorship: Provide ongoing technical guidance and mentorship, establish development and deployment best practices, and promote a culture of continuous improvement. Strategic Stakeholder Engagement: Engage with senior-level corporate and operational leadership to build relationships and provide executive presence through impactful presentations. Team Morale and Success: Foster an environment that supports high team morale and tenacity in achieving success goals. Be a player-coach, hands-on with team activities, and drive team efficiency and productivity Qualifications: Educational Background: Bachelor's or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Electrical, or Electronics Engineering. Industry Experience: At least 10 years in the software industry, including 4+ years in leadership roles managing cloud-based SaaS products. Technical Expertise: Proficient in Three.js, WebGL, cloud services (AWS/Azure), API design, and modern software development practices. Experience with Agile methodologies and DevOps practices. Hands-on technical leader who can be player/coach for architecture and designs. Strong in scalable cloud and data architecture. Experience with SQL and NoSQL technologies are mandatory Leadership Skills: Demonstrated ability to manage large teams and complex projects within a matrix organizational structure. Strong capability in mentorship and team development. Communication Skills: Excellent verbal and written communication abilities; adept at handling presentations and engaging with stakeholders across all levels of the organization. Strategic Vision: Ability to translate business needs into actionable technological strategies and detailed execution plans.
